Is your teen struggling through a difficult breakup? Dr. Maria Ashford is consulted in this article published in Business Insider, and offers her perspective on how to support your child. Some parents have a hard time knowing what to say when their children experience heartache, but it’s important to validate the child’s feelings and encourage them to open up. Dr. Ashford sees heartbreak as one of many factors that may be leading to an increase in anxiety and stress. She suggests that you check in with your teen, making sure that even if they aren’t talking to you that they have someone they trust who they can talk to.
